    Where to Fish Finder

    Hey guys ,
    If anybody used the DNR Where to Fish Finder web site to check out lakes in Indiana you know that it was a good way to check location , size and find new places to fish . Well the gov. couldnt leave well enough alone . The link is http://www.in.gov/dnr/fishwild/3591.htm and it says if you double click on the icon for a lake info will come up but its not doing that on my computer - I dont think its just me . The addition of the Google Earth mapping is nice but knowing the name of the lake you are looking at would be better . Let me know if any of you have better luck . Oh , went fishin last week and the gill are still bedding in the southern part of the state and the bass were biting pretty good on 10" Power Worms .
